Book Riot s SFF Deals for March 7  2022 - 12Book Riot s SFF Deals for March 7  2022 - 50Book Riot s SFF Deals for March 7  2022 - 95Book Riot s SFF Deals for March 7  2022 - 57Book Riot s SFF Deals for March 7  2022 - 23